The Basic Principles Of createssh
The Basic Principles Of createssh
Blog Article
Get paid to write down complex tutorials and choose a tech-focused charity to receive a matching donation.
The technology approach starts. You will end up requested in which you want your SSH keys to be saved. Push the Enter crucial to just accept the default location. The permissions to the folder will protected it to your use only.
For those who did not offer a passphrase for your private essential, you will be logged in promptly. If you provided a passphrase for that non-public important if you established The true secret, you're going to be needed to enter it now. Afterwards, a fresh shell session is going to be made for yourself Using the account within the remote technique.
For this tutorial We're going to use macOS's Keychain Access plan. Begin by adding your important to the Keychain Access by passing -K choice to the ssh-include command:
For anyone who is With this situation, the passphrase can avert the attacker from instantly logging into your other servers. This will with any luck , Provide you time to develop and put into practice a whole new SSH important pair and take away entry in the compromised key.
Right before finishing the actions in this part, Make certain that you either have SSH critical-primarily based authentication configured for the foundation account on this server, or ideally, you have SSH essential-primarily based authentication configured for an account on this server with sudo entry.
The distant Computer system now recognizes that you have to be who you say you are for the reason that only your personal important could extract the session Id within the createssh concept it despatched for your Laptop or computer.
ssh-keygen is often a command-line Instrument accustomed to crank out, take care of, and transform SSH keys. It enables you to develop safe authentication credentials for remote accessibility. You may find out more about ssh-keygen And exactly how it really works in How to make SSH Keys with OpenSSH on macOS or Linux.
When you enter a passphrase, you'll have to offer it when you utilize this crucial (Unless of course you are jogging SSH agent application that shops the decrypted vital). We advocate utilizing a passphrase, however , you can just press ENTER to bypass this prompt:
All over again, to make numerous keys for various web sites just tag on something like "_github" to the tip from the filename.
You could ignore the "randomart" that's displayed. Some distant desktops could teach you their random artwork each time you connect. The reasoning is that you're going to identify In case the random art modifications, and become suspicious with the link because it means the SSH keys for that server are actually altered.
In businesses with quite a lot of dozen consumers, SSH keys effortlessly accumulate on servers and service accounts over time. We have now witnessed enterprises with many million keys granting entry to their production servers. It only takes just one leaked, stolen, or misconfigured critical to achieve access.
To start with, the Software requested exactly where to save the file. SSH keys for person authentication usually are stored inside the user's .ssh Listing under the home Listing.
For anyone who is now familiar with the command line and trying to find Guidelines on employing SSH to connect with a remote server, make sure you see our collection of tutorials on Creating SSH Keys for A variety of Linux operating methods.